How Cellulose Powder Can Improve Digestive Health

Cellulose powder is a dietary supplement that is gaining popularity for its potential benefits in improving digestive health. Cellulose is a type of fiber that is found in plant cell walls and is indigestible by the human body. When consumed in the form of cellulose powder, it can help support digestive function in several ways.

One of the primary benefits of cellulose powder is its ability to promote regular bowel movements. Fiber is essential for maintaining healthy digestion, as it adds bulk to the stool and helps move waste through the digestive tract. Cellulose powder can help prevent constipation by increasing the frequency and ease of bowel movements.

In addition to promoting regularity, cellulose powder can also help support overall gut health. Fiber acts as a prebiotic, providing fuel for beneficial bacteria in the gut. These bacteria play a crucial role in maintaining a healthy balance of microorganisms in the digestive system, which is essential for proper digestion and immune function.

Furthermore, cellulose powder can help regulate blood sugar levels by slowing down the absorption of glucose in the intestines. This can be particularly beneficial for individuals with diabetes or those at risk of developing the condition. By stabilizing blood sugar levels, cellulose powder can help prevent spikes and crashes in energy levels and reduce the risk of developing insulin resistance.

Another potential benefit of cellulose powder is its ability to promote satiety and aid in weight management. Fiber-rich foods have been shown to increase feelings of fullness and reduce overall calorie intake, which can help support weight loss efforts. By adding cellulose powder to your diet, you may feel more satisfied after meals and be less likely to overeat.

It is important to note that while cellulose powder can offer several benefits for digestive health, it is essential to consume an adequate amount of water when taking fiber supplements. Fiber absorbs water in the digestive tract, so staying hydrated is crucial to prevent constipation and ensure the proper functioning of the digestive system.

Q&A

1. What is cellulose powder?
Cellulose powder is a fine white powder made from cellulose fibers, which are found in the cell walls of plants.

2. What are some common uses of cellulose powder?
Cellulose powder is commonly used as a bulking agent, anti-caking agent, and stabilizer in food products. It is also used in pharmaceuticals, cosmetics, and as a thickening agent in various industrial applications.

3. Is cellulose powder safe for consumption?
Yes, cellulose powder is generally recognized as safe for consumption by regulatory agencies such as the FDA. It is non-toxic and does not have any known adverse effects when consumed in moderate amounts.
